Лабораторные работы №1-5 по дисциплине "Защита информации". Вариант №7.
Состав работы
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Работа представляет собой rar архив с файлами (распаковать онлайн), которые открываются в программах:
- Microsoft Word
Описание
Лабораторная работа № 1
Написать и отладить набор подпрограмм (функций), реализующих алгоритмы возведения в степень по модулю, вычисление наибольшего общего делителя, вычисление инверсии по модулю.
2. Используя написанные подпрограммы, реализовать систему Диффи-Хеллмана, шифры Шамира, Эль-Гамаля и RSA, в частности:
2.1. Для системы Диффи-Хеллмана с параметрами p = 30803, g = 2, XA = 1000, XB = 2000 вычислить открытые ключи и общий секретный ключ.
2.2. Для шифра Шамира с параметрами p = 30803, g = 2, cA = 501, cB = 601 и сообщения m = 11111 вычислить dA, dB, x1, x2, x3, x4.
2.3. Для шифра Эль-Гамаля с параметрами p = 30803, g = 2, c = 500, k = 600 и сообщения m = 11111 вычислить зашифрованное сообщение.
2.4. Для шифра RSA с параметрами пользователя P = 131, Q = 227, d = 3 и сообщения m = 11111 вычислить зашифрованное сообщение.
Лабораторная работа № 2
Задание
Пусть источник без памяти порождает буквы из алфавита {0, 1, 2, ..., 9} с вероятностями 0.4, 0.2, 0.1, 0.05, 0.05, 0.05, 0.05, 0.04, 0.03, 0.03 соответственно. Пусть используется шифр Цезаря
e = (m + k) mod 10
с ключом k, выбираемым равновероятно из этого же алфавита.
Написать программу, которая
1) вычисляет расстояние единственности для этого шифра;
2) для введенного зашифрованного сообщения (например, 3462538) вычисляет апостериорные вероятности использования различных ключей.
Лабораторная работа № 3
Задание
Выполнить программную реализацию шифра по ГОСТ 28147-89.
Написать программу, которая, используя полученную реализацию шифра, зашифровывает сообщение в режимах ECB, CBC, OFB и CTR (сообщение, режим и ключ задаются при запуске программы).
Написать программу, которая расшифровывает ранее зашифрованное сообщение.
Лабораторная работа № 4
Разработать программы для генерации и проверки подписей по ГОСТ Р34.10-94. Рекомендуемые значения общих открытых параметров q = 787, p = 31481, a = 1928. Остальные параметры пользователей выбрать самостоятельно. Хеш-функцию реализовать на основе блокового шифра по ГОСТ 28147-89.
Лабораторная работа № 5
Задание
Выполнить компьютерную реализацию протокола "Электронные деньги". Все необходимые параметры выбрать самостоятельно
Выберем два простых числа P = 19 и Q = 193.
Написать и отладить набор подпрограмм (функций), реализующих алгоритмы возведения в степень по модулю, вычисление наибольшего общего делителя, вычисление инверсии по модулю.
2. Используя написанные подпрограммы, реализовать систему Диффи-Хеллмана, шифры Шамира, Эль-Гамаля и RSA, в частности:
2.1. Для системы Диффи-Хеллмана с параметрами p = 30803, g = 2, XA = 1000, XB = 2000 вычислить открытые ключи и общий секретный ключ.
2.2. Для шифра Шамира с параметрами p = 30803, g = 2, cA = 501, cB = 601 и сообщения m = 11111 вычислить dA, dB, x1, x2, x3, x4.
2.3. Для шифра Эль-Гамаля с параметрами p = 30803, g = 2, c = 500, k = 600 и сообщения m = 11111 вычислить зашифрованное сообщение.
2.4. Для шифра RSA с параметрами пользователя P = 131, Q = 227, d = 3 и сообщения m = 11111 вычислить зашифрованное сообщение.
Лабораторная работа № 2
Задание
Пусть источник без памяти порождает буквы из алфавита {0, 1, 2, ..., 9} с вероятностями 0.4, 0.2, 0.1, 0.05, 0.05, 0.05, 0.05, 0.04, 0.03, 0.03 соответственно. Пусть используется шифр Цезаря
e = (m + k) mod 10
с ключом k, выбираемым равновероятно из этого же алфавита.
Написать программу, которая
1) вычисляет расстояние единственности для этого шифра;
2) для введенного зашифрованного сообщения (например, 3462538) вычисляет апостериорные вероятности использования различных ключей.
Лабораторная работа № 3
Задание
Выполнить программную реализацию шифра по ГОСТ 28147-89.
Написать программу, которая, используя полученную реализацию шифра, зашифровывает сообщение в режимах ECB, CBC, OFB и CTR (сообщение, режим и ключ задаются при запуске программы).
Написать программу, которая расшифровывает ранее зашифрованное сообщение.
Лабораторная работа № 4
Разработать программы для генерации и проверки подписей по ГОСТ Р34.10-94. Рекомендуемые значения общих открытых параметров q = 787, p = 31481, a = 1928. Остальные параметры пользователей выбрать самостоятельно. Хеш-функцию реализовать на основе блокового шифра по ГОСТ 28147-89.
Лабораторная работа № 5
Задание
Выполнить компьютерную реализацию протокола "Электронные деньги". Все необходимые параметры выбрать самостоятельно
Выберем два простых числа P = 19 и Q = 193.
Дополнительная информация
Уважаемый слушатель, дистанционного обучения,
Оценена Ваша работа по предмету: Защита информации
Вид работы: Лабораторная работа 5
Оценка: Зачет
Дата оценки: 22.10.2016
Рецензия:Уважаемый С*
Мерзлякова Екатерина Юрьевна
Оценена Ваша работа по предмету: Защита информации
Вид работы: Лабораторная работа 5
Оценка: Зачет
Дата оценки: 22.10.2016
Рецензия:Уважаемый С*
Мерзлякова Екатерина Юрьевна
Похожие материалы
Лабораторные работы №1-5 По дисциплине: Защита информации. Вариант №5.
freelancer
: 17 августа 2016
Лабораторные работы №1
Тема: Шифры с открытым ключом
Задание:
1. Написать и отладить набор подпрограмм (функций), реализующих алгоритмы возведения в степень по модулю, вычисление наибольшего общего делителя, вычисление инверсии по модулю.
2. Используя написанные подпрограммы, реализовать систему Диффи-Хеллмана, шифры Шамира, Эль-Гамаля и RSA, в частности:
2.1. Для системы Диффи-Хеллмана с параметрами p = 30803, g = 2, XA = 1000, XB = 2000 вычислить открытые ключи и общий секретный ключ.
2.2 Для
100 руб.
Лабораторные работы №1-5 по дисциплине: Защита информации. Вариант №1.
freelancer
: 27 августа 2016
Лабораторная работа №1
Тема: Шифры с открытым ключом (Глава 2)
Задание:
1. Написать и отладить набор подпрограмм (функций), реализующих алгоритмы возведения в степень по модулю, вычисление наибольшего общего делителя, вычисление инверсии по модулю.
2. Используя написанные подпрограммы, реализовать систему Диффи-Хеллмана, шифры Шамира, Эль-Гамаля и RSA, в частности:
2.1. Для системы Диффи-Хеллмана с параметрами p = 30803, g = 2, XA = 1000, XB = 2000 вычислить открытые ключи и общий секретный ключ
100 руб.
Лабораторные работы №1-5 по дисциплине: Защита информации. Вариант №1
popye
: 10 декабря 2015
!СКИДКА! На все свои работы могу предложить скидку до 50%. Для получения скидки напишите мне письмо(выше ссылка "написать")
Лабораторная работа №1
Тема: Шифры с открытым ключом (Глава 2)
Задание:
1. Написать и отладить набор подпрограмм (функций), реализующих алгоритмы возведения в степень по модулю, вычисление наибольшего общего делителя, вычисление инверсии по модулю.
2. Используя написанные подпрограммы, реализовать систему Диффи-Хеллмана, шифры Шамира, Эль-Гамаля и RSA, в частности:
2.1. Дл
80 руб.
Лабораторные работы №№1-5 по дисциплине: Защита информации. Вариант общий.
Учеба "Под ключ"
: 18 декабря 2016
Лабораторная работа №1:
Задание
1. Написать и отладить набор подпрограмм (функций), реализующих алгоритмы возведения в степень по модулю, вычисление наибольшего общего делителя, вычисление инверсии по модулю.
2. Используя написанные подпрограммы, реализовать систему Диффи-Хеллмана, шифры Шамира, Эль-Гамаля и RSA, в частности:
2.1. Для системы Диффи-Хеллмана с параметрами p = 30803, g = 2, XA = 1000, XB = 2000 вычислить открытые ключи и общий секретный ключ.
2.2 Для шифра Шамира с параметрами p =
650 руб.
Лабораторные работы №1-5 по дисциплине "Защита информации", вариант №2
selkup
: 12 октября 2015
Пусть источник без памяти порождает буквы из алфавита {0, 1, 2, ..., 9} с вероятностями 0.4, 0.2, 0.1, 0.05, 0.05, 0.05, 0.05, 0.04, 0.03, 0.03 соответственно. Пусть используется шифр Цезаря
Выполнить программную реализацию шифра по ГОСТ 28147-89.
Написать программу, которая, используя полученную реализацию шифра, зашифровывает сообщение в режимах ECB, CBC, OFB и CTR (сообщение, режим и ключ задаются при запуске программы).
400 руб.
Онлайн Тест 5 по дисциплине: Защита информации.
IT-STUDHELP
: 29 сентября 2023
Вопрос No1
Какие операции используются в алгоритме шифра ГОСТ 28147-89?
сложение слов по модулю 232
сложение слов по модулю 216
циклический сдвиг слова влево на указанное число бит
побитовое «исключающее или» двух слов
побитовая операция «и» двух слов
Вопрос No2
Какие из криптосистем базируются на задаче дискретного логарифма?
система Диффи-Хэллмана
шифр Шамира
шифр Эль-Гамаля
шифр RSA
Вопрос No3
Какие из пар чисел являются взаимно простыми?
24, 27
22, 25
26, 27
18, 2
450 руб.
Лабораторная работа №5 по дисциплине "Защита информации"
kanchert
: 17 мая 2015
Тема: Криптографические протоколы (Глава 6)
Задание:
Выполнить компьютерную реализацию протокола "Электронные деньги". Все необходимые параметры выбрать самостоятельно.
Лабораторная работа №5 по дисциплине "Защита информации"
Greenberg
: 3 августа 2011
Криптография.
Тема: Криптографические протоколы (Глава 6)
Задание:
Выполнить компьютерную реализацию протокола "Электронные деньги". Все необходимые параметры выбрать самостоятельно.
79 руб.
Другие работы
Информационно-измерительная система
VikkiROY
: 13 ноября 2012
Техническое задание
Перечень используемых сокращений
Введение
Основная часть
Расчет параметров радиотехнической системы
1. Расчет параметров преобразования сообщения в цифровую форму
1.1 Случай №1
1.2 Случай №2
1.3 Случай №3
2. Расчет и выбор параметров для радиолинии передачи информации с объекта
2.1 Определение параметров системы с ВРК и АМН
2.2 Расчет энергетических характеристик
3. Организация синхронизации
4. Расчет параметров радиолинии «ЦП – объект»
5. Выбор характеристик системы оп
5 руб.
Контрольная работа по дисциплине: Методы оптимизации. Вариант №03
IT-STUDHELP
: 12 февраля 2020
Задача 1
Производственная фирма может выпускать любые из четырех
видов продукции. Затраты ограниченных ресурсов, цены реализации продукции в предстоящем временном периоде представлены в следующей таблице.
Прод.1 Прод.2 Прод.3 Прод.4 Объем ресурса
Ресурс 1 (ед.рес./ед.прод.) 4 5 9 12 277
Ресурс 2 (ед.рес./ед.прод.) 13 11 5 4 391
Цена (ден.ед./ед.прод.) 510 384 420 432
В плановом периоде фирма располагает ресурсами в следующих объемах:
Ресурс 1 в объёме 277 единиц
Ресурс 2 в об
230 руб.
Методы оценки рыночной стоимости предприятия (организации, фирмы)
ostah
: 2 марта 2015
Введение.
Теоретическая глава.
Теоретические аспекты методологии оценки рыночной стоимости предприятия (организации, фирмы).
История развития оценочной деятельности в России и в мире.
Понятие и правовые основы оценочной деятельности в России.
Характеристика методов оценки рыночной стоимости предприятии (организаций и фирм). Практическая глава.
Направления совершенствования оценочной деятельности в России.
Расчет рыночной стоимости ОАО «Светлый путь» затратным методом.
Сравнительный анализ
111 руб.
Контрольная работа №2 по дисциплине «Программирование и основы алгоритмизации»
fedovlaa
: 15 октября 2012
«Даны действительные числа a1, a2, ..., an.
Если в результате замены отрицательных членов последовательности a1, a2, ..., an
их квадратами члены будут образовывать неубывающую последовательность,
то получить сумму членов исходной последовательности;
в противном случае получить их произведение»
Вводим исходные данные.
a, b, с d – массивы целых чисел
p, s - переменные вещественного типа (произведение, сумма).
i, j - переменные целого типа (счетчики).
n - переменная целого